服务器百度蜘蛛抓取不稳定是什么原因导致的?

小白
预计阅读时长 6 分钟
位置: 首页 服务器 正文

服务器百度蜘蛛抓取不稳定是许多网站运营者常遇到的问题,这种现象会直接影响网站在搜索引擎中的收录表现和流量获取,百度蜘蛛作为搜索引擎的重要爬虫程序,其抓取行为的稳定性直接关系到网站内容的索引效率,当服务器端出现异常时,蜘蛛的抓取频率、深度和成功率都会受到显著影响,进而可能导致网站排名波动或收录延迟。

服务器百度蜘蛛抓取不稳定是什么原因导致的?

服务器稳定性对蜘蛛抓取的影响机制

服务器的稳定性是蜘蛛抓取的基础保障,若服务器频繁出现宕机、响应超时或带宽不足等问题,百度蜘蛛在抓取过程中会遭遇连接失败或数据加载缓慢的情况,当服务器响应时间超过3秒时,蜘蛛可能会主动降低抓取频率,甚至暂时放弃对该站点的抓取,服务器IP若被频繁更换或被搜索引擎误判为异常,也可能导致蜘蛛的信任度下降,从而减少抓取频次。

常见的技术原因分析

  1. 服务器性能瓶颈:CPU、内存或磁盘I/O资源不足会导致服务器处理请求能力下降,尤其在蜘蛛高并发抓取时,容易引发队列拥堵。
  2. 网络环境问题:机房带宽不足、网络波动或CDN配置不当,会造成蜘蛛抓取请求延迟或丢包。
  3. 配置错误:robots.txt文件设置不当(如禁止抓取关键目录)、服务器防火墙规则拦截蜘蛛IP,或HTTP返回状态码错误(如503、404),均会干扰蜘蛛的正常抓取行为。
  4. 安全策略干扰:频繁触发WAF(Web应用防火墙)的防御机制,可能导致IP被临时封禁,影响蜘蛛的持续抓取。

优化建议与解决方案

提升服务器硬件性能

选择配置更高的服务器或升级云服务套餐,确保在蜘蛛抓取高峰期(如凌晨26点)仍能保持稳定的响应速度,可通过监控工具(如Zabbix)实时跟踪服务器资源使用率,及时发现并处理性能瓶颈。

优化网络与CDN配置

确保服务器带宽充足,并选择与百度蜘蛛访问路径匹配的机房节点,合理配置CDN缓存策略,避免对动态内容过度缓存,导致蜘蛛抓取到过时数据。

服务器百度蜘蛛抓取不稳定是什么原因导致的?

规范技术配置

  • 检查robots.txt文件,确保允许百度蜘蛛抓取重要页面。
  • 优化网站结构,减少死链和404错误,设置合理的301重定向。
  • 配置服务器返回正确的HTTP状态码,避免因500或503错误误导蜘蛛。

加强安全策略兼容性

在WAF规则中添加百度蜘蛛IP的白名单(如125.71.*等百度段IP),避免误判,限制单IP的请求频率,防止恶意爬虫影响正常抓取。

提交sitemap与主动推送

通过百度站长工具定期提交sitemap,并使用主动推送接口(如API调用)实时更新页面,帮助蜘蛛更快发现新内容,定期检查抓取诊断工具中的异常报告,针对性解决问题。

长期监控与维护

建立常态化监控机制,通过百度搜索资源平台的抓取异常数据,结合服务器日志分析蜘蛛行为模式,若发现蜘蛛抓取间隔突然拉长,需排查服务器是否遭受攻击或资源耗尽问题,保持网站代码和服务器系统的及时更新,避免因漏洞引发稳定性问题。

服务器百度蜘蛛抓取不稳定是什么原因导致的?

相关问答FAQs

Q1:如何判断服务器是否影响百度蜘蛛抓取?
A:可通过百度站长工具的“抓取诊断”功能查看页面抓取失败率,结合服务器日志分析是否存在频繁超时、连接错误或带宽不足等问题,若蜘蛛抓取频次持续低于行业平均水平,且服务器响应时间较长,则需重点优化服务器性能。

Q2:服务器迁移后百度蜘蛛抓取异常怎么办?
A:服务器迁移可能导致IP更换或环境配置变化,需立即检查新IP是否被百度收录,并通过站长工具提交站点迁移申请,确保新服务器的robots.txt、HTTP状态码等配置与原站点一致,并通过主动推送加速蜘蛛对新环境的适应,通常12周内抓取行为会逐步恢复稳定。

-- 展开阅读全文 --
头像
国外服务器ping不通电信宽带IP是网络问题还是限制?
« 上一篇 2025-12-09
服务器吞吐量计算公式及影响因素有哪些?
下一篇 » 2025-12-09
取消
微信二维码
支付宝二维码

最近发表

动态快讯

网站分类

标签列表

目录[+]